2
Purpose of this document The purpose of this FAQ Document on Vitria - chan check is to provide the insights to BCH HUB AMS Team on the steps to follow to perform the chan check activity in Production Environment. This document is not an exhaustive one in nature but give bare-minimal information for AMS Team to perform the chan check activity. This document may have to be used along with additional Vitria Product Information, if any. What is chan check? The data file written by the Vitria server Chanserv.dat file will grow day by day, so by performing the chancheck activity we will shrunk file size. How to perform chan check? Please perform the following activities, 1. Login to the PMS1/PMS2 server 2. Disable cronos on the PMS server 3. Stop all vitria components (like Connectors, Automators) 4. Run stopservs command to stop the vitria businessware services 5. Follow the chan check procedure 6. Run the startservs command to start the vitria business ware services 7. Start the Vitria components on UNIX server 8. Perform sanity testing 9. Enable the crons on the UNIX server chan check procedure Follow the steps, given below, to perform chan check procedure: Step 1: Go to folder: $VITRIA/data/live

FAQ for ChanCheck

Embed Size (px)

Citation preview

Page 1: FAQ for ChanCheck

Purpose of this documentThe purpose of this FAQ Document on Vitria - chan check is to provide the insights to BCH HUB AMS Team on the steps to follow to perform the chan check activity in Production Environment. This document is not an exhaustive one in nature but give bare-minimal information for AMS Team to perform the chan check activity. This document may have to be used along with additional Vitria Product Information, if any.

What is chan check?The data file written by the Vitria server Chanserv.dat file will grow day by day, so by performing the chancheck activity we will shrunk file size.

How to perform chan check?Please perform the following activities,

1. Login to the PMS1/PMS2 server2. Disable cronos on the PMS server 3. Stop all vitria components (like Connectors, Automators)4. Run stopservs command to stop the vitria businessware services5. Follow the chan check procedure6. Run the startservs command to start the vitria business ware services7. Start the Vitria components on UNIX server8. Perform sanity testing9. Enable the crons on the UNIX server

chan check procedure

Follow the steps, given below, to perform chan check procedure:Step 1: Go to folder:

$VITRIA/data/live

Step 2: Execute the command: chancheck -d chanserv1_v3.dat -w chanserv1_v3.wal -k

Step 3: Observe the response: Scanning object list ... Scan complete.

Step 4: Enter command -write ctemp.dat (then Press Enter)

Step 5: Observe the response:

Page 2: FAQ for ChanCheck

Wrote ...

Step 6: Enter command - quit (press Enter)

Step 7: Observe the response: Stabilizing log ... Deleting chanserv2_v2.wal Exiting.

Step 8: copy chanserv1_v3.dat file to chanserv1_v3.dat.10202011

Step 9: Rename ctemp.dat to chanserv1_v3.dat

This completes the shrinking of the data file